Ответ 1
Вам просто нужно добавить селектор jquery после URL.
Смотрите: http://api.jquery.com/load/
Пример прямо из API:
$('#result').load('ajax/test.html #container');
Итак, что это значит, он загружает элемент #container из указанного URL.
Из этого кода вы увидите, что он загружает URL-адрес контента из хэш-тега. В любом случае, для загрузки только одного элемента div с этой внешней страницы.
$(function() {
if(location.hash) $("#content_inload").load(location.hash.substring(1));
$("#nav a").click(function() {
$("#content_inload").load(this.hash.substring(1));
});
});
так что после .substring(#inload_content(1))
но это не работает.
Спасибо
Вам просто нужно добавить селектор jquery после URL.
Смотрите: http://api.jquery.com/load/
Пример прямо из API:
$('#result').load('ajax/test.html #container');
Итак, что это значит, он загружает элемент #container из указанного URL.
Да, см. "Загрузка фрагментов страницы" на http://api.jquery.com/load/.
Короче говоря, вы добавляете селектор после URL. Например:
$('#result').load('ajax/test.html #container');